Mesothelioma Lawyers Can Help You File Mesothelioma Asbestos Claims

Many families of those who have been affected by mesothelioma are awarded compensation as a result of a mesothelioma trial settlement or verdict. The compensation may also come from asbestos trust funds or the Department of Veterans Affairs.

Mesothelioma lawsuits are typically framed as personal injury lawsuits or wrongful death claims. A mesothelioma attorney can help you determine which kind of claim is the best to bring.

Trust Funds

Asbestos victims must be compensated for their losses, which includes medical expenses, lost income, and suffering. Compensation from the asbestos lawsuit trust funds can help cover these costs. Asbestos Trust funds are reserves set aside by the manufacturers of asbestos-containing products. The funds were set up in the 1980s after companies knowingly exposed workers to the dangerous material and fil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ection to stay out of liability in lawsuits.

Typically each trust fund assigns a specific schedule of value to different types of asbestos-related ailments with the more serious conditions being valued higher than others. Each trust also has a percentage of payment, which is the portion of the total claim they'll pay out. Asbestos attorneys assist victims in maximizing their compensation by filing claims with multiple asbestos trust fund.

It is important to make an asbestos trust fund claim as soon as possible after diagnosis to ensure that compensation is received in a timely manner. The timeline varies depending on the circumstances, but most victims receive their compensation within 90 days of submitting their claim. Some victims can qualify for expedited review, which permits them to receive a predetermined amount of compensation that is based on the asbestos company's established standards.

The average mesothelioma payout from a fund is $1 million or more. The exact amount will depend on the asbestos companies that are involved in the claim of the individual and the trust's percentage of payment.
